How they compare
Hungary currently reports 16.81 deaths per 100,000 people against 15.83 deaths per 100,000 people in New Zealand, a difference of 0.98 deaths per 100,000 people.
That makes Hungary's figure about 1.1 times New Zealand's.
The two have swapped places 12 times across 64 shared years of data; in 1955 it was New Zealand ahead.
Hungary ranks 34th and New Zealand ranks 37th of 111 countries.
New Zealand has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Hungary | New Zealand |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1950s | 10.53 deaths per 100,000 people | 18.51 deaths per 100,000 people | 7.99 deaths per 100,000 people | New Zealand |
| 1960s | 15.74 deaths per 100,000 people | 17.99 deaths per 100,000 people | 2.24 deaths per 100,000 people | New Zealand |
| 1970s | 20.2 deaths per 100,000 people | 20.95 deaths per 100,000 people | 0.7504 deaths per 100,000 people | New Zealand |
| 1980s | 20.04 deaths per 100,000 people | 21.96 deaths per 100,000 people | 1.92 deaths per 100,000 people | New Zealand |
| 1990s | 21.46 deaths per 100,000 people | 24.41 deaths per 100,000 people | 2.95 deaths per 100,000 people | New Zealand |
| 2000s | 18.17 deaths per 100,000 people | 21.13 deaths per 100,000 people | 2.96 deaths per 100,000 people | New Zealand |
| 2010s | 15.89 deaths per 100,000 people | 16.28 deaths per 100,000 people | 0.3915 deaths per 100,000 people | New Zealand |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
